Dedhel is a Rural village located in Saintala, Balangir, Odisha.
The total population of Dedhel is 303.
Dedhel village comprises 75 households.
The literacy rate in Dedhel is 73.1%. Among the literate population of 185, there are 108 literate males and 77 literate females.
In Dedhel, there are 150 males and 153 females, with a sex ratio of 1020 females per 1000 males.
There are 50 children (16.5% of population), comprising 24 boys and 26 girls.
The total number of workers in Dedhel is 102, with 20 main workers and 82 marginal workers.
In Dedhel, there are 171 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(84 males, 87 females) and 97 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(49 males, 48 females).
Dedhel is located in Odisha state, Balangir district, and falls under Saintala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 421175 and LGD code is 421175.
